Custom Extended Loader
Overview
The Custom Extended Loader represents a purpose-built adaptation of conventional wheel loaders, engineered to address specific challenges in material handling and earthmoving operations. These machines are distinguished by their extended structural components, which may include lengthened booms, modified linkage systems, or telescoping arms. The design philosophy centers on maintaining operational stability while achieving greater vertical or horizontal reach compared to standard models. Manufacturers typically develop these configurations in collaboration with end-users to meet precise application requirements. Common variants include high-lift models for truck loading in deep pits and long-reach configurations for portside operations. The customization process often involves computer-aided engineering simulations to validate structural integrity under the unique load distributions created by extended components.
Structure and Working Principle
Structurally, Custom Extended Loaders incorporate several critical modifications to their kinematic chains. The boom assembly undergoes significant redesign, with added gusseting and reinforced pivot points to handle increased bending moments. Many models implement a parallel-linkage system to maintain bucket orientation throughout the extended range of motion. The hydraulic system receives upgrades to larger-capacity cylinders and potentially additional circuit controls for precise positioning. The working principle remains similar to standard loaders but with enhanced geometric considerations. Operators must account for the altered center of gravity and modified load charts. Advanced models may include stability control systems that automatically adjust hydraulic pressure distribution based on real-time load sensing. Some configurations employ counterweight extensions or outrigger systems to compensate for the increased moment arms during operation.
Key Features
Extended reach capability stands as the definitive feature, with working ranges typically extending 3-7 meters beyond standard models. This is achieved through carefully engineered boom and arm assemblies that maintain structural rigidity while minimizing weight penalties. Many units incorporate wear-resistant liners at stress points and self-lubricating bushings to accommodate the increased angular deflections during operation. Modern variants often include intelligent load management systems that provide real-time feedback on load distribution and stability margins. Some high-end models feature automated cycle optimization that adjusts movement patterns based on the extended geometry. For cold climate operations, specialized hydraulic oil heating systems ensure consistent performance despite the increased fluid volume in extended circuits.
Application Areas
Primary applications center around scenarios where conventional loaders cannot achieve sufficient reach or dump height. In mining operations, extended loaders efficiently load haul trucks from deeper benches without requiring additional digging passes. Port facilities utilize them for handling bulk materials in high-sided vessels or stacked storage configurations. The construction sector employs these machines for specialized tasks like bridge deck loading or high-rise material placement. Waste management applications include reaching into deep transfer stations or compactors. Some agricultural operations use modified versions with extra-long forks for silo loading. The machines prove particularly valuable in confined work areas where repositioning standard equipment would be impractical or time-consuming.
Maintenance and Precautions
Extended loaders demand rigorous maintenance protocols focused on structural components. Daily inspections should include thorough examination of all weld points and stress areas, with particular attention to boom-root sections. Hydraulic systems require more frequent fluid analysis due to the extended line lengths and increased cylinder volumes. Operational precautions include strict adherence to modified load charts and avoidance of side-loading scenarios that could induce torsional stresses. Many manufacturers recommend installing strain gauges at critical points for continuous monitoring. When working on slopes, the altered center of gravity necessitates revised stability calculations. Proper storage should include boom support stands to prevent sagging during prolonged downtime.
B2B Procurement Guide
Procuring Custom Extended Loaders requires thorough needs analysis and vendor capability assessment. Buyers should develop detailed specifications covering required reach dimensions, cycle times, and material density handling capabilities. Leading manufacturers typically require 12-24 weeks for custom builds, with prototyping available for unique applications. Total cost of ownership calculations must account for higher maintenance requirements and potential productivity gains. Leasing options may be preferable for short-duration projects. Evaluation criteria should include the manufacturer's experience with similar customizations, availability of replacement parts for extended components, and training programs for operators and maintenance staff. Third-party engineering review of custom designs is recommended for critical applications.
